Scope and Contents

One leaf containing a page of handwritten biographical notes on Revolutionary War hero General John Stark in Bentley's hand. The note is written on the verso of a short letter from J. Pitcairn regarding a deliver for the "Rev. D. Bently" dated March 2, 1810. The notes were likely copied from the biographical sketch published in the Essex Register May 1, 1810.

Biographical / Historical

William Bentley was a friend of General John Stark and noted in his diary on May 2, 1810, "Yesterday was inserted in the Register of Salem, the first no. of the Biographical Sketch of General John Stark. I suspect we are indebted to his Son in Law Stickney for this Sketch, It is written in the original simplicity of the Author, but might have preserved its simplicity & yet have had a neater dress."
